/** * This file represents an example of the code that themes would use to register * the required plugins. * * It is expected that theme authors would copy and paste this code into their * functions.php file, and amend to suit. * * @package TGM-Plugin-Activation * @subpackage Example * @version 2.3.6 * @author Thomas Griffin * @author Gary Jones * @copyright Copyright (c) 2012, Thomas Griffin * @license http://opensource.org/licenses/gpl-2.0.php GPL v2 or later * @link https://github.com/thomasgriffin/TGM-Plugin-Activation */ /** * Include the TGM_Plugin_Activation class. */ require_once dirname( __FILE__ ) . '/class-tgm-plugin-activation.php'; add_action( 'tgmpa_register', 'my_theme_register_required_plugins' ); /** * Register the required plugins for this theme. * * In this example, we register two plugins - one included with the TGMPA library * and one from the .org repo. * * The variable passed to tgmpa_register_plugins() should be an array of plugin * arrays. * * This function is hooked into tgmpa_init, which is fired within the * TGM_Plugin_Activation class constructor. */ function my_theme_register_required_plugins() { /** * Array of plugin arrays. Required keys are name and slug. * If the source is NOT from the .org repo, then source is also required. */ $plugins = array( // This is an example of how to include a plugin pre-packaged with a theme array( 'name' => 'Contact Form 7', // The plugin name 'slug' => 'contact-form-7', // The plugin slug (typically the folder name) 'source' => get_stylesheet_directory() . '/includes/plugins/contact-form-7.zip', // The plugin source 'required' => true, // If false, the plugin is only 'recommended' instead of required 'version' => '', // E.g. 1.0.0. If set, the active plugin must be this version or higher, otherwise a notice is presented 'force_activation' => false, // If true, plugin is activated upon theme activation and cannot be deactivated until theme switch 'force_deactivation' => false, // If true, plugin is deactivated upon theme switch, useful for theme-specific plugins 'external_url' => '', // If set, overrides default API URL and points to an external URL ), array( 'name' => 'Cherry Plugin', // The plugin name. 'slug' => 'cherry-plugin', // The plugin slug (typically the folder name). 'source' => PARENT_DIR . '/includes/plugins/cherry-plugin.zip', // The plugin source. 'required' => true, // If false, the plugin is only 'recommended' instead of required. 'version' => '1.1', // E.g. 1.0.0. If set, the active plugin must be this version or higher, otherwise a notice is presented. 'force_activation' => true, // If true, plugin is activated upon theme activation and cannot be deactivated until theme switch. 'force_deactivation' => false, // If true, plugin is deactivated upon theme switch, useful for theme-specific plugins. 'external_url' => '', // If set, overrides default API URL and points to an external URL. ) ); /** * Array of configuration settings. Amend each line as needed. * If you want the default strings to be available under your own theme domain, * leave the strings uncommented. * Some of the strings are added into a sprintf, so see the comments at the * end of each line for what each argument will be. */ $config = array( 'domain' => CURRENT_THEME, // Text domain - likely want to be the same as your theme. 'default_path' => '', // Default absolute path to pre-packaged plugins 'parent_menu_slug' => 'themes.php', // Default parent menu slug 'parent_url_slug' => 'themes.php', // Default parent URL slug 'menu' => 'install-required-plugins', // Menu slug 'has_notices' => true, // Show admin notices or not 'is_automatic' => true, // Automatically activate plugins after installation or not 'message' => '', // Message to output right before the plugins table 'strings' => array( 'page_title' => theme_locals("page_title"), 'menu_title' => theme_locals("menu_title"), 'installing' => theme_locals("installing"), // %1$s = plugin name 'oops' => theme_locals("oops_2"), 'notice_can_install_required' => _n_noop( theme_locals("notice_can_install_required"), theme_locals("notice_can_install_required_2") ), // %1$s = plugin name(s) 'notice_can_install_recommended' => _n_noop( theme_locals("notice_can_install_recommended"), theme_locals("notice_can_install_recommended_2") ), // %1$s = plugin name(s) 'notice_cannot_install' => _n_noop( theme_locals("notice_cannot_install"), theme_locals("notice_cannot_install_2") ), // %1$s = plugin name(s) 'notice_can_activate_required' => _n_noop( theme_locals("notice_can_activate_required"), theme_locals("notice_can_activate_required_2") ), // %1$s = plugin name(s) 'notice_can_activate_recommended' => _n_noop( theme_locals("notice_can_activate_recommended"), theme_locals("notice_can_activate_recommended_2") ), // %1$s = plugin name(s) 'notice_cannot_activate' => _n_noop( theme_locals("notice_cannot_activate"), theme_locals("notice_cannot_activate_2") ), // %1$s = plugin name(s) 'notice_ask_to_update' => _n_noop( theme_locals("notice_ask_to_update"), theme_locals("notice_ask_to_update_2") ), // %1$s = plugin name(s) 'notice_cannot_update' => _n_noop( theme_locals("notice_cannot_update"), theme_locals("notice_cannot_update_2") ), // %1$s = plugin name(s) 'install_link' => _n_noop( theme_locals("install_link"), theme_locals("install_link_2") ), 'activate_link' => _n_noop( theme_locals("activate_link"), theme_locals("activate_link_2") ), 'return' => theme_locals("return"), 'plugin_activated' => theme_locals("plugin_activated"), 'complete' => theme_locals("complete"), // %1$s = dashboard link 'nag_type' => theme_locals("updated") // Determines admin notice type - can only be 'updated' or 'error' ) ); tgmpa( $plugins, $config ); } Understanding Cricket Betting A Comprehensive Guide 159616580

Understanding Cricket Betting A Comprehensive Guide 159616580

Understanding Cricket Betting A Comprehensive Guide 159616580

How to Read Cricket Betting: A Comprehensive Guide

Cricket betting is more than just a game of chance; it's about understanding the nuances of the sport and being able to make informed decisions. Whether you are a seasoned bettor or a newbie looking to get started, learning how to read cricket betting is crucial for maximizing your experience and success. In this guide, we will cover everything from the basics of cricket betting odds to advanced strategies, including how to interpret match conditions and player performances. If you're looking for a reliable platform to start your betting journey, consider checking out How to Read Cricket Betting Odds on Joya9 joya 9 bd.

Understanding the Basics of Cricket Betting

At its core, cricket betting involves placing a wager on the outcome of a cricket match or tournament. The betting market can be complex, but familiarizing yourself with a few key terms will help you navigate it more easily.

Key Terms in Cricket Betting

  • Odds: Odds indicate the probability of a specific outcome occurring and the potential payout if your bet is successful. Odds can be displayed in various formats, including fractional, decimal, and American.
  • Match winner: This is the most straightforward bet, where you simply pick the team you believe will win the match.
  • Top batsman/bowler: Bets can be placed on which player will score the most runs (top batsman) or take the most wickets (top bowler) in a match.
  • Over/Under: This involves betting on whether the total runs or wickets in a match will be above or below a specified number.
  • Live betting: This allows you to place bets while the match is ongoing, often using changing odds as the game progresses.

Types of Cricket Bets

Cricket betting offers a plethora of options. Here are some common types of bets you might encounter:

  • Match Betting: You bet on the outcome of a match (win/lose).
  • Series Betting: Wagering on the outcome of a series of matches, such as a Test series between two countries.
  • Prop Bets: These include bets on specific events during the match, such as which player will score the most runs or whether a certain player will take a wicket.
  • Futures Betting: Placing bets on the outcome of a tournament well in advance (like who will win the ICC World Cup).

How to Read Cricket Betting Odds

Understanding how to read odds is crucial for making informed betting decisions. Let's break down the three most common formats:

Fractional Odds

Commonly used in the UK, fractional odds display the profit relative to your stake. For instance, odds of 5/1 mean that for every unit you bet, you'll win five units if your bet is successful. Your total return will be your stake plus your profit.

Decimal Odds

Popular in Europe and Australia, decimal odds represent the total payout for a winning bet, including your stake. For example, odds of 6.0 mean that for every dollar you wager, you'll receive $6 back total if you win (your stake plus $5 profit).

American Odds

Also known as moneyline odds, American odds can be either positive or negative. A positive number (e.g., +200) shows how much profit you would make on a $100 bet, while a negative number (e.g., -150) indicates how much you need to wager to win $100.

Factors to Consider When Betting

Making informed betting decisions involves considering various factors. Here are some essential aspects to keep in mind:

Team Form and Performance

Analyze the recent form of teams and players. A team's past performance can reveal trends and provide insight into their current capabilities. Look for consistent players who can influence the game's outcome.

Match Conditions

Weather conditions can significantly impact a cricket match. For example, wet conditions might favor bowlers, while dry pitches can benefit batsmen. Always check the weather forecast before placing your bets.

Head-to-Head Records

Understanding Cricket Betting A Comprehensive Guide 159616580

Historical performance between two teams can offer valuable insights. Some teams perform better against specific opponents due to various factors, including team composition, pitch conditions, and player head-to-head stats.

Player Availability

Injuries, suspensions, and fatigue can affect player performance. Always check the latest news regarding player availability before making your bet.

Strategies for Successful Betting

To improve your chances of success, consider adopting the following strategies:

Start with Research

Invest time in researching teams, players, stats, and betting markets. Knowledge is power when it comes to betting.

Bankroll Management

Set a budget for your betting activities and stick to it. Avoid chasing losses, and only bet what you can afford to lose.

Shop for the Best Odds

Different bookmakers may offer varying odds on the same events. Take the time to compare odds and choose the best options available.

Conclusion

Cricket betting can be a rewarding and exciting pursuit when approached with knowledge and strategy. By understanding how to read cricket betting odds, considering key factors, and employing sound betting strategies, you can enhance your betting experience and improve your chances for success. Always remember to gamble responsibly, and may your bets bring you joy and excitement!